WebGrafting has long been used to produce novel varieties of roses, citrus species, and other plants. In grafting, two plant species are used; part of the stem of the desirable plant is grafted onto a rooted plant called the stock.The part that is grafted or attached is called the scion.Both are cut at an oblique angle (any angle other than a right angle), placed in … WebApr 9, 2024 · 32: Plant Reproduction. Plant reproduction in plants can be accomplished via either sexual or asexual mechanisms. Sexual reproduction produces offspring by the fusion of gametes, resulting in offspring genetically different from the parent or parents. Asexual reproduction produces new individuals without the fusion of gametes, …
